The second part of the "Trilogy of Murderous Love": a story about a "colleague" of the heroes of the dark novel "The Butcher and the Blackbird"!
Hired assassin Lachlan Kane works in his leather studio and dreams of forgetting his traumatic past and living a quiet life. But when he fails an order for his boss's most important client, Lachlan realizes that he will never get out of the underground world. At least until Lark Montague offers him a deal: use his skills to track down the killer, and she will find a way to secure his freedom. What's the catch?
First, he must marry her.
And they can't stand each other.
Lark is like a ray of sunshine that breaks through the clouds and envelops every crack that Lachlan Kane tries to hide. He considers her a spoiled princess, but Lark has many secrets that he hides in the shadow of her bright glow.
Lachlan and Lark navigate the dark world that has bound them, and it becomes increasingly difficult to understand whether their marriage is fake or real. But they are haunted by more than the usual dangers.
Another ghost lurks on their doorstep.
And he thirsts for blood.
